WebFused spurs are not to be confused with residual current device (RCD) sockets, which are built to automatically switch off live current. By doing this, RCB sockets can protect anyone in contact with a device from electrocution in the event of a fault or short circuit (the flow of electrical current into a circuit with insufficient resistance). Other forms of fuse are either re-wireable fuses and cartridge fuses. Cartridge fuses are simply fuse wire contained in an enclosed glass or ceramic tube (such as the fuse in a plug).

WebSRCD – socket outlet incorporating an RCD to BS 7288; FCURCD – fused spur with RCD integrated, and; PRCD – a device that contains a portable RCD within the plug.
